Abstract
The problems associated with the synthesis, characterization and application of $SnO_2$-Au nanocomposites for the optimization of conductometric gas sensors have been discussed in this report. Nanocomposites have been synthesized on the surface of $SnO_2$ films using successive ionic layer deposition(SILD) method. It has been shown that the proposed approach to surface modification of metal oxide films is an excellent method for the optimization of the operating characteristics of $SnO_2$-based gas sensors, being developed for the detection of reducing gases as well as ozone.
